Destrukturyzacja
Destrukturyzacja to technika, która umożliwia programistom wyodrębnianie wartości z obiektów i tablic w JavaScript i przypisywanie ich do zmiennych w jednej linii kodu. Pozwala to na bardziej zwięzły i czytelny kod, a także ułatwia manipulowanie danymi.
Nauka
React
JavaScript
31 marca 2023
Destrukturyzacja
Destrukturyzacja to bardzo przydatna funkcja w JavaScript, która pozwala nam wyciągnąć konkretne wartości z obiektów lub tablic i przypisać je do zmiennych. Jest to sposób na uproszczenie kodu i zwiększenie jego czytelności.
"Destrukturyzacja w JavaScript jest bardzo potężnym narzędziem, które pozwala programistom na łatwiejsze i szybsze manipulowanie danymi."
Destrukturyzacja obiektów
Aby zacząć korzystać z destrukturyzacji obiektów, należy umieścić w nawiasach klamrowych nazwy właściwości, których wartości chcemy przypisać do zmiennych. Na przykład, jeśli mamy obiekt o nazwie person, którego właściwości to name i age, możemy przypisać ich wartości do zmiennych w ten sposób:
const person = {name: 'Szymon',age: 30};const { name, age } = person;console.log(name); // Szymonconsole.log(age); // 30
Dzięki temu możemy odwołać się do wartości name i age, nie używając składni person.name i person.age.
Jeśli chcemy przypisać wartości do zmiennych o innych nazwach, możemy to zrobić w ten sposób:
const person = {name: 'Szymon',age: 30};const { name: personName, age: personAge } = person;console.log(personName); // Szymonconsole.log(personAge); // 30
Dzięki temu nazwa zmiennej będzie inna niż nazwa właściwości obiektu.
Destrukturyzacja tablic
Destrukturyzacja tablic działa w podobny sposób, ale zamiast nazw właściwości używamy indeksów. Na przykład, jeśli mamy tablicę z nazwami miesięcy, możemy wyciągnąć pierwszy i trzeci miesiąc w ten sposób:
const months = ['January', 'February', 'March', 'April', 'May'];const [firstMonth, , thirdMonth] = months;console.log(firstMonth); // Januaryconsole.log(thirdMonth); // March
Dzięki temu możemy pominąć niepotrzebne wartości i przypisać tylko te, które nas interesują.
Podsumowanie
Destrukturyzacja jest bardzo przydatną funkcją w JavaScript, która pozwala nam wyciągnąć konkretne wartości z obiektów lub tablic i przypisać je do zmiennych. Dzięki temu możemy upraszczać kod i zwiększać jego czytelność. Mam nadzieję, że ten artykuł pomógł Ci lepiej zrozumieć destrukturyzację w JavaScript!